Austrian Army during the French Revolutionary and Napoleonic Wars

The Imperial-Royal or Imperial Austrian Army (German: Kaiserlich-königliche Armee, abbreviated k.k. Armee), during the French Revolutionary and Napoleonic Wars, was the armed force of the Habsburg monarchy under its last monarch, the Habsburg Emperor Francis II, composed of the Emperor's army.
